Output 3df1b8d0274e0e25a17f15f7e4f200b43957cf07325a9b3f58f68a811b3a66e4:21

value
5138229
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 273230923476efaf755177cb3c39fe58d2040958 OP_EQUALVERIFY OP_CHECKSIG
address
14aFUj3zBDKKFUJ2DfqTyb9nNzpcb7AfJW
transaction
3df1b8d0274e0e25a17f15f7e4f200b43957cf07325a9b3f58f68a811b3a66e4
spent
true